Description
The University of Texas at Arlington (UTA), located in the heart of the Dallas-Fort Worth metroplex, is a dynamic public research university known for its diverse academic offerings, particularly in engineering, nursing, and business. As a part of the renowned University of Texas System, UTA offers a wide range of undergraduate, graduate, and doctoral programs. The university’s commitment to research, innovation, and providing practical learning experiences, along with its diverse and inclusive campus community, makes UTA a key institution for students seeking a comprehensive educational experience in a thriving urban setting.
National Merit
University of Texas at Arlington no longer offers a scholarship specifically for National Merit Finalists. However, please see the Additional Scholarship Opportunities section below for other scholarship opportunities that you may quality for.
Additional Scholarship Opportunities
The University of Texas at Arlington offers several merit-based scholarships for new undergraduate students, emphasizing academic excellence and college access.
- Presidential Honors Scholarship – $13,000/year
- Presidential Scholarship – $10,000/year
- Maverick Academic Scholarship – up to $1,000 – $8,000/year
